1С8

Registrul de informații este, în esență, cel mai apropiat de director.

Cu toate acestea, există o serie de diferențe importante, dintre care unele sunt enumerate mai jos.

În al doilea rând, registrul de informații are o compoziție de detalii cheie desemnate de dezvoltator, denumite măsurători. Combinația dintre rechizitele cheie identifică în mod unic înregistrarea, adică, două sau mai multe intrări au aceeași valoare de detalii cheie nu poate fi, prin definiție. Aceasta este, de exemplu, un registru stocare de informații pe durata zilelor de lucru cu detaliile „Data“ și „Time“ recuzita „Data“ va fi cheia, iar „Durata“ nu este, la fel ca în informațiile registru ar trebui să fie doar o singură intrare pentru fiecare data.







În al treilea rând, este posibil un mod de înregistrare în registrul de informații cu depunerea la registrator. Adică, înscrierile în registrul de informații vor fi executate prin documente și dacă aceste documente vor fi anulate în cazul îndepărtării automate a mișcărilor, aceste înregistrări vor fi șterse.

În al patrulea rând, registrul de informații poate fi periodic. Adică, informațiile din el pot fi diferite în momente diferite. Un exemplu clasic este cursurile de schimb, astăzi rata este una, mâine rata aceleiași valute poate fi diferită. Acesta este motivul pentru care informațiile care variază în timp, ar trebui să fie stocate într-un registru de informații, deoarece metodele de lucru cu datele din registre permit utilizarea de tabele agregate „felie de primul“ și „ultima felie“, în cazul în care puteți obține o înregistrare, acționând pe un moment dat.







În cele din urmă, răspunsul la întrebarea cum să citiți și să scrieți registrul de informații.

  • Metodele "Selectați" și "Selectați la Registrator" vă permit să preluați înregistrările ținând cont de selecția specificată.
  • Metoda "Obțineți" vă permite să obțineți o intrare pentru care selecția pentru toate detaliile cheie este trecută în parametrii metodei.
  • Metodele "Get the First" și "Get the Last" vă permit să obțineți prima sau ultima înregistrare a registrului periodic de date, care satisface selecția în parametrii metodei.
  • Metodele "Cut First" și "CuttingLast" vă permit să obțineți o secțiune a primei sau ultimei înregistrări corespunzătoare selecției în parametrii metodei respectiv.

În plus față de aceste metode există două metode, „SozdatMenedzherZapisi“ și „SozdatNaborZapisey“, cu care puteți crea obiectul „RegistrSvedeniyMenedzherZapisi“, respectiv, sau „RegistrSvedeniyNaborZapisey“, iar apoi setați valorile tuturor sau unora dintre detaliile cheie și folosind „Citiți“ metoda pe obiect pentru a efectua citirea în obiectul înregistrării din baza de date, care satisface valorile atribuite de detaliile cheie.

Ca rezultat, obținem un obiect care conține una sau mai multe înregistrări de care avem nevoie.

Se înregistrează informațiile din registru se face prin intermediul metodelor deja menționate „SozdatMenedzherZapisi“ și „SozdatNaborZapisey“ obiect „RegistrSvedeniyMenedzher“. Puteți crea fie un obiect, apoi completați detaliile înregistrării sau o listă de înregistrări și înregistrați obiectul utilizând metoda "Scrieți". Sau de a crea un obiect, setați valorile tuturor sau unora dintre detaliile-cheie pentru utilizarea „Citiți“ metoda pe obiect pentru a efectua citirea în înregistrările obiect din baza de date care satisface valorile atribuite detaliile-cheie, și apoi efectuați metoda de „Clear“ și apoi trebuie să efectueze metoda de „Remove“ sau completați detaliile înregistrării sau listei de înregistrări și înregistrați obiectul utilizând metoda "Scrieți".







Trimiteți-le prietenilor: